

Journalist Receives Threat After Criticizing Cuban Dictatorship
A sports journalist, Armando Campuzano, who recently published a book highly critical of the Cuban dictatorship, has reported receiving a threatening phone call. Campuzano, speaking in the video, said, "I received a phone call that worries me a great deal; a threat against one of my children." He described the caller as speaking in broken Spanish, suggesting an attempt to disguise their identity. Campuzano has lived in Canada for eight years, but the threat highlights the long reach of the Cuban regime and the risks faced by those who dare to criticize it. The video, recorded in his car, shows a man visibly shaken and concerned. He urges viewers to share the video, hoping to raise awareness and potentially deter further action.
